Uploaded image for project: 'Network Controller'
  1. Network Controller
  2. SDNC-214

Multi-site High-availability - Kubernetes Federation + Manual Failover (POC)

XMLWordPrintable

    • Icon: Story Story
    • Resolution: Done
    • Icon: Medium Medium
    • Beijing Release
    • None
    • None
    • None

      As a user of SDNC, I want a Geo-redundant deployment that builds on the existing site-resilient solution that leverages Kubernetes cluster.

       

      This proof of concept leverages Kubernetes Federation to ensure the two sites can talk to each other in a way that allows native features to be exported.  For this solution, it is ok if I need to manually detect an issue with a given site and need to perform a set of manual steps to switch the active/standby role of each site.

      This will build on top of https://wiki.onap.org/display/DW/SDN-C+Clustering+on+Kubernetes

      • All required configuration, even though Geo-redundancy shall be disabled by default
      • Measurements of solution against KPI of interest.
      • Configuration or procedure to ensure that requests get routed to the active site.

      In Beijing, this will just be a proof of concept.

       

      Exclusion

      • Simple health reporting API or script
      • Simple role switching API or script
      • Automatic detection of site heath issue and switching of roles.

            jmac jmac
            chiz99 chiz99
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ated:
              Resolved: